Syllabus context
Part of Chemical Bonding and Molecular Structure in JEE Main Chemistry.
- Kossel-Lewis approach to chemical bond formation, the concept of ionic and covalent bonds
- Ionic Bonding: Formation of ionic bonds, factors affecting the formation of ionic bonds; calculation of lattice enthalpy
- Covalent Bonding: Concept of electronegativity, Fajan's rule, dipole moment, Valence Shell Electron Pair Repulsion (VSEPR) theory and shapes of simple molecules
- Quantum mechanical approach to covalent bonding: Valence bond theory its important features, the concept of hybridization involving s, p and d orbitals, resonance
- Molecular Orbital Theory: Its important features, LCAOs, types of molecular orbitals (bonding, antibonding), sigma and pi-bonds
- Molecular orbital electronic configurations of homonuclear diatomic molecules, the concept of bond order, bond length and bond energy
- Elementary idea of metallic bonding, hydrogen bonding and its applications
